A chance to learn more about the great work being done by community and agencies to protect the Koalas of the Far South Coast
About this event
You are invited to come along to hear the results of recent koala monitoring efforts and to learn about the cultural burning and other environmental works happening to protect the koala population on the Far South Coast. You will hear from the community group - Koala Action Network, South East Local Land Services, Firesticks Alliance, Yuin cultural practitioners, and others.
Find out how you can get involved in improving koala habitat and protecting the threatened population on the Far South Coast.
